Don't you put speaker in those enclosure things? :pardon:

most people try too! What I was trying to say was a speaker (all things being equal) will sound exactly the same inverted or not. Of course, all things won't be the same if you simply invert the subs in the same box as the net volume of your box will change. Even then, a speaker will not magically sound better if it is inverted. Of course, I am answering his question assuming when he asked if it will sound better he means that from an SQ perception and not just to mean will it be louder.
